PALO ALTO, Calif. – February 19, 2026 — D-Wave Quantum Inc. today joined the Southeastern Quantum Collaborative (SQC) as an inaugural member, along with The University of Alabama in Huntsville, Davidson Technologies, IBM and Alabama A&M University.The SQC will bring together academia, industry and government to accelerate the advancement and application of quantum information science and technology across the Southeast. In addition, it aims to develop the quantum-ready workforce needed to commercialize the technology. Given Davidson hosts a D-Wave Advantage2TM system at its headquarters in Huntsville, Alabama, D-Wave is well positioned to support the SQC’s quantum workforce development efforts.“Alabama has long been a leader in the development and use of advanced technologies, and D-Wave is excited to join the Southeastern Quantum Collaborative as an inaugural member to support the next wave of innovation coming from the region — quantum computing,” said Jack Sears, vice president of government business solutions at D-Wave. “Establishing a globally competitive, quantum-ready workforce across the Southeast — capable of operationalizing annealing and gate-model systems for mission-critical decision-making, large-scale operational efficiency, and the protection of national interests — will be decisive in accelerating adoption throughout the region’s public and private sectors. By investing in quantum talent and infrastructure, the Southeast can position itself as a national leader in quantum innovation, advanced manufacturing, energy, logistics, and defense.”“The SQC aims to leverage the region’s unique concentration of cleared defense infrastructure, advanced missile defense expertise, and strong base of prime contractors to accelerate the transition of quantum information science and technology into field-ready capabilities for the warfighter,” said Dr. Rainer Steinwandt, dean of the College of Science at the University of Alabama in Huntsville. “The Collaborative’s goal is to transform the Southeastern United States into a global quantum computing leader.
